Your new role

We are looking for a Finance Business Partner to provide direction and financial support, insight, challenge and partnership to the leadership team of the Regional Investment Programme in the Major Projects Directorate within National Highways. The roleholder will be responsible for the maintenance of strong financial control and governance, and will play a critical role in performance management, capital and resource planning and the development of financial strategy.

Here at National Highways we are striving for excellence, so if you are looking for a new opportunity to shape a high performing team within a progressive organisation please see below.

What you’ll be leading on
- Provide specialist and trusted direction and support, challenge and advice on all financial matters to the leadership team of the role holder’s allocated business areas. Contribute and provide financial leadership to all key strategic and commercial decisionmaking and planning, budgeting and forecasting processes, to drive the long-term performance and delivery of the investment strategy
- Ensure financial results are clearly communicated, budgets and forecasted outcomes are reviewed and presented accurately and key issues in business performance are identified and communicated across a region / division / programme, and that options areestablished and plans put in place to address deviations from budget in a clear and timely manner.
- Take responsibility for the integrity of financial controls and information, including oversight of relevant journals and reconciliations, as well as checking and challenging submissions from the business, ensuring the production and dissemination of accurateand timely financial data
- Facilitate the adoption of new business and finance processes and lead their roll-out in the region/partnered area; for example: efficiency identification & management, business case methodology, changes in Target Operating Model, and integrated capitalplanning
- Lead the annual business planning process and longer-term financial planning for the role holder’s allocated business areas, co
- ordinating those responsible for providing inputs and ensuring that all are aware of key targets, pressures and messages
- Support and encourage the development of robust business cases, through proactive engagement with Senior Responsible Owners, project teams and Subject Matter Advisers to ensure that the case is acceptable for submission to the relevant Board and that theLead Finance Business Partner (and, as relevant, the Chief Financial Officer) is adequately briefed to contribute meaningfully to the discussion of each case

To be successful
- Chartered qualified accountant with previous finance, governance and commercial experience
- Previous experience of supporting the development of other team members to ensure resilience and plug knowledge gaps, and training colleagues on financial matters where appropriate
- Understanding and working experience of managing a business planning process at a regional/area level
- Evidence of communicating project/programme objectives to all those with responsibility for developing budgets, and taking responsibility for ensuring budget outputs align with targets
- Experience in excellent stakeholder management

Our benefits package

Our total reward package includes basic salary, the potential for a performance related bonus, and employer pension contributions of up to 10%.

We also offer:

- Annual Leave starting at 26 days (plus Bank Holidays) rising by 1 day each year up to 31 days (plus Bank Holidays)
- Flexible hours and blended working between base location/home
- Life assurance of 4 times annual salary
- Health and wellbeing support, including an Employee Assistance Programme, available 24/7 365 days and network of mental health first aiders. Plus access to a wellbeing app to enhance your self-care 24/7, Occupational health service and flu vaccines
- A cycle to work scheme for the purchase of a bicycle and equipment for healthy, low carbon travel
- Significant investment in your career development, through learning and development, talent management, coaching, mentoring and on job experience

And we are:

- Family friendly with enhanced maternity leave and pay, paternity leave (15 days), shared parental leave, adoption leave. Plus access to financial support for holiday play schemes and paid special leave (up to 5 days pa), eg for caring responsibilities
- Money friendly with access to a discounts platform including over 3000 discounts for supermarkets, eating out, leisure, holidays. Alongside a financial wellbeing programme

Community friendly - offering paid leave to volunteer, 3 days basic/year plus an extra 3 days to support the national Covid effort
